Role of cytokines produced by T helper immune-modulators in dengue pathogenesis: A systematic review and meta-analysis
Acta Tropica ( IF 2.7 ) Pub Date : 2021-01-07 , DOI: 10.1016/j.actatropica.2021.105823
Linh Tran , Ibrahim Radwan , Le Huu Nhat Minh , Soon Khai Low , Mohammad Rashidul Hashan , Mohammad Diaa Gomaa , Mohamed Abdelmongy , Abdullah Abdel Aziz , Alaa Mohamed , Gehad Mohamed Tawfik , Shusaku Mizukami , Kenji Hirayama , Nguyen Tien Huy

Background and objectives

Modulation of the immune reaction is essential in the development of various diseases, including dengue's “Cytokine Tsunami”, an increase in vascular permeability with concomitant severe vascular leakage. We aim to identify the role of T-helper (Th) cells, Th2 and Th7, with their related cytokines in dengue pathogenesis.

Material and methods

Nine electronic databases and manual search were applied to detect available publications. A meta-analysis using a fixed- or random-effect model was performed to measure standardized mean difference (SMD) with 95% confidence interval (CI). The National Institute of Health (NIH) tools for observational cohort, cross-sectional, and case-control studies were used to examine the risk of bias. The protocol was recorded in PROSPERO with CRD42017060230.

Results

A total of 38 articles were found including 19 case-control, 11 cross-sectional and 8 prospective cohort studies. We indicated that Th2 cytokines (IL-4, IL-6, IL-8) and Th17 cytokine (IL-17) in dengue patients were notably higher than in a healthy control group in acute phase (SMD = 1.59, 95% CI [0.68, 2.51], p = 0.001; SMD = 1.24, 95% CI [0.41, 2.06], p = 0.003; SMD = 1.13, 95% CI [0.61, 1.66], p<0.0001; SMD = 1.74, 95% CI [0.87, 2.61], p<0.0001), respectively.

Conclusions

This study provides evidence of the significant roles of IL-4, IL-6, IL-8, IL-10 and IL-17 in the pathogenesis of developing a severe reaction in dengue fever. However, to fully determine the association of Th cytokines with dengue, it is necessary to perform further studies to assess kinetic levels during the duration of the illness.

T辅助免疫调节剂产生的细胞因子在登革热发病中的作用:系统综述和荟萃分析

背景和目标

免疫反应的调节对于各种疾病的发展至关重要,包括登革热的“细胞因子海啸”,即血管通透性的增加以及严重的血管渗漏。我们旨在确定T辅助(Th)细胞,Th2和Th7及其相关的细胞因子在登革热发病机理中的作用。

材料与方法

九个电子数据库和手动搜索被用来检测可用的出版物。进行了使用固定或随机效应模型的荟萃分析,以95%置信区间(CI)衡量标准均值差(SMD)。美国国立卫生研究院(NIH)用于观察性队列研究,横断面研究和病例对照研究的工具用于检查偏倚的风险。该协议已在PROSPERO中使用CRD42017060230进行了记录。

结果

共发现38篇文章,包括19例病例对照,11篇横断面和8篇前瞻性队列研究。我们指出,登革热患者的Th2细胞因子(IL-4,IL-6,IL-8)和Th17细胞因子(IL-17)在急性期显着高于健康对照组(SMD = 1.59,95%CI [ 0.68,2.51],p  = 0.001; SMD = 1.24,95%CI [0.41,2.06],p  = 0.003; SMD = 1.13,95%CI [0.61,1.66],p <0.0001; SMD = 1.74,95%CI [0.87,2.61],p<0.0001)。

结论

这项研究提供了IL-4,IL-6,IL-8,IL-10和IL-17在登革热严重反应发展过程中的重要作用的证据。但是,要完全确定Th细胞因子与登革热的关联,有必要进行进一步的研究以评估疾病持续期间的动力学水平。
